Today it was announced by Starboard Games LLC, the production of INT, a rogue-like sci-fi RPG in development for PC, Mac and Linux. The team released a trailer today, developed using in-engine footage of the first level of the game.

Check out the fourth trailer of INT, featuring the story of the game:

“The new trailer represents the team’s commitment to releasing a free, fully playable demo of the game in November of this year. The demo will showcase game assets, the world, environments, and characters that you will journey with during the main quest.

INT is a Sci-Fi RPG with roguelike and western elements. The game has a heavy focus on exploration, dungeon crawling, character customization and story, brought to you by indie enthusiasts. The focus is on the character’s journey through a war-torn world through randomized and pre-set levels with fast-paced combat against hordes of enemies. The player must accomplish quests like a traditional RPG, complete objectives, and meet crew members which will aid in survival. Throughout the game you can side and complete missions through criminal cartels, and the two major combatants, the UCE and ACP, of the Interstellar Civil War.

November Demo Features:

  • A feature complete level and dungeon from the INT demo. 
  • Richly developed characters who interact with each other, as well as the player
  • A deep, involved story set in the height of the Interstellar War

The team is working towards that November release date, inspired by real-world architecture, research, and the team’s favorite sci-fi adventures. Built with a deep love of indie games, the game will be showcased at Clifton Forge in September, 2016 and Raleigh in February, 2017.   A second demo is expected in Q2-Q3 2017 which will be the final demo release and again be free and publically available to the community.”
